Lake-Effect Snow — Southern Cayuga, New York

2012-02-12 · Southern Cayuga, New York

Event narrative

Localized heavy lake effect snow occurred off of Lake Ontario and Cayuga Lake, resulting in a widely ranging 4 to 11 inches of snow in Southern Cayuga County. This includes 11.0 inches 3 miles southeast of Dresserville, and 7.8 inches in Summer Hill. Most of the snow fell in the morning to early afternoon hours.

Wider weather episode

Arctic air spilled across Lake Ontario and the Finger Lakes from the north-northwest, resulting in localized heavy bands of lake effect snow for portions of Cortland and Southern Cayuga Counties.
